Nicolas Kowalski <Nicolas.Kowalski@imag.fr> writes:

> There is variable `nnmail-treat-duplicates' set to `delete' by
> default. It does not seem to work with nnimap. Did I miss something ?

Yes, nnimap is not based on nnmail.  (Though there might be changes
in the most recent CVS that make nnimap use the duplicate detection
code from nnmail -- anyone?)

I think the other feature in Gnus that has to do with duplicates is
"suppression", not treatment.
